Lacquered Coffins is a simple and fast-play WW2 air combat game aimed at between 4 and 20 aircraft per side. The game focuses on the interaction of fighters, bombers, ground attack and utility aircraft, and can be played on a 4' X 4' or 4' X 6' table. What does Lacquered Coffins offer? • Good balance of historical accuracy and simplicity • Bombing, Torpedo attacks and Reconnaissance all play an important role • Based on the first-hand accounts of pilots • 6 Missions included, land or sea battles can be fought • Stats included for over 200 Aircraft • Luftwaffe, RAF, Soviet, US, Japanese and Italian air forces all covered • 3 Periods - Early Mid and Late, showing the evolution of aircraft during the war • 4 Pilot qualities available - Poor quality pilots are less effective, aces are deadly • Free-form squadron building; aircraft, pilots and ordnance have points values • Simple to play, games take less than 2 hours Lacquered Coffins is aimed at 1/600 or 1/300 scale miniatures, but 1/144 could be used just as easily. The game requires minimal equipment, just dice, a tape measure and a circular protractor - No fancy flying stands necessary!
